This week, we celebrate Catholic Education Week. It is a time to give thanks for the gift of Catholic education and reflect on how faith guides our learning, our relationships, and our actions.

This year, we are proud to share a special video created by the Saskatchewan Catholic School Boards Association (SCSBA). The video honours Catholic Education Week and highlights a path forward rooted in respect, understanding, and reconciliation.

In the video, we see how Catholic teachings and Indigenous ways of knowing can come together as we answer the Call to Action. It shows how both traditions call us to care for one another, honour creation, and walk gently with others. It reminds us that reconciliation is not a single act, but an ongoing journey.

As a school community, we are committed to learning, listening, and growing together. We are grateful for the opportunity to walk this path in a good way.
